I usually interpret the sex annotation as only applying to dioecious plant species that have separate male and female individuals. This means that the annotation is really only applicable to a few plant species. For a plant with fruits/seeds, I would just mark them as fruiting under phenology. That is more likely to be searched than female to find out when a species is producing seeds.
